Pairs Trade Idea Update: Long SBK /Short INLI promised myself I would also focus on a market neutral strategy. Yesterday (Pre-Market, Monday 10-May) I add 1 idea to my report: Long Standard Bank (SBK)/Short Investec (INL). As of 2pm on Tuesday afternoon, the pair was higher by 4.84% over the 2-day period vs -1.6% for the All Share Index for the same period. It closed +4.33%. Market neutral strategies are used by traders to reduce risk while simultaneously attempting to generate alpha. To achieve this, traders make use of pairs trades which involves matching a long position with a short position in two stocks with a high correlation. I'll continue to monitor for opportunities in this strategy. by LD_Perspectives3
